A lot of powerful forces are at work that will destroy the Olympics as we've known it for the past 124 years. Since the beginning in 1896, the US collegiate system has provided tge vast majority of Olympic athletes from the US & have provided tge training for many non-US participants. That is all threatened now by shortsighted college administrators. They see only their own dollars, but don't see the long-term repercussions upon a whole lot of others over many decades.
